Fort Mill Ridge Wildlife Management Area

Rugged Appalachian ridge terrain with mixed hardwood forest, open ridgetops and sweeping valley views — ideal for landscape panoramas, seasonal color (especially fall), and wildlife (songbirds, deer). Best at golden hour for warm side-light on ridgelines; spring for wildflowers and migration; winter for stark silhouettes.
